Olympics Presenter Admits Drinking Before Slurred Report

An Australian television presenter has admitted to consuming alcohol before a live Winter Olympics broadcast where she slurred her words while reporting on iguanas.

The presenter initially attributed her slurred speech to the cold, altitude, and not having eaten dinner. However, she later issued an apology, acknowledging that she 'had a drink' before going on-air. The incident went viral after viewers noticed her unclear pronunciation during the report from the Winter Olympics.

The network has not commented on whether disciplinary action will be taken against the presenter, whose name has not been released in the reports about the incident.
